SEVA Travelers offers host organizations to choose from across Malaysia, providing volunteers the opportunity to contribute to initiatives focused on refugee support, animal welfare, ocean conservation, and community-based environmental programs. Volunteers will collaborate with impactful nonprofits that are building long-term organizational capacity through fundraising strategy, grant writing, donor engagement, and communications development, all while experiencing Malaysia’s diverse cultures, landscapes, and communities.
These vetted and verified NGOs include:
Fugee – Malaysia
A nonprofit supporting the refugee community in Malaysia, where legal protections for refugees are limited and public sentiment is often xenophobic. Volunteers will strengthen the organization’s fundraising capacity, including proposal writing, access to global funders, and designing a five-year fundraising strategy. Additional support may include marketing and communications strategies to increase awareness and engagement internationally.
My Pets Haven – Malaysia
A volunteer-driven animal shelter caring for around 50 dogs and 10 cats. Volunteers will assist in improving volunteer recruitment processes, financial sustainability, and the adoption program to help more pets find loving homes. Additional support may include fundraising guidance, donor engagement, and operational management for day-to-day shelter activities.
Reef Check Malaysia – Malaysia
A marine conservation nonprofit focused on ocean and reef preservation. Volunteers will support the organization by identifying and building a database of international funders, philanthropic foundations, and family trusts, as well as designing Monitoring, Learning & Evaluation (MLE) systems to track project impact across Malaysia.
Bambusa Foundation – Lenggong, Perak
Focused on social forestry programs in a UNESCO World Heritage site. Volunteers will help strengthen the foundation’s community forestry initiatives, fundraising strategies, and donor engagement to ensure long-term program sustainability.
SPCA Kota Kinabalu – Sabah, Borneo
A registered animal welfare organization caring for over 300 animals, including rescued strays and victims of abuse. Volunteers will support fundraising efforts, public engagement campaigns, and strategic planning to ensure sufficient funding for shelter operations, veterinary care, and rescue programs. Additional tasks may include community outreach, communications, and volunteer coordination.
